Pincode 605755
Postal PIN code 605755 belongs to Villupuram district, Tamil Nadu. It covers 10 post offices.
| Post Office | District | State | Circle |
|---|---|---|---|
| Karanai B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Paranur B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| S.Kodungal B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Sathiyakandanur B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Arulavadi B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Kadaganur B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Sennakunam B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Arcadu B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Ayandur B.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|
| Mogaiyur S.O | Villupuram | Tamil Nadu | Tamilnadu Circle |

What is a PIN code (postal pincode)?
A Postal Index Number (PIN) code is a 6-digit code used by India Post to identify a delivery post office. The first digit denotes the region, the first three the sorting district, and the last three the specific post office.
